Application deadlines
- Winter semester (October start) — Bachelor's programmes15 July
Confirmed, matches the stored rule. Application window opens 1 May. Bachelor's programmes start only in the winter semester; there is no summer intake. Source: https://www.ksh-muenchen.de/studierendensekretariat

How much money do you need to show for a student visa to Germany?
For a student residence permit in Germany you must prove €11,904 per year (2026, DAAD / Study in Germany — proof of financing (blocked account, 992 EUR/month for 12 months): https://www.study-in-germany.com/en/plan-your-studies/requirements/proof-of-financing/).

Accommodation
KSH is one of 16 higher-education institutions served by Studierendenwerk München Oberbayern, so enrolled students can apply for a subsidized dorm room. As a small church-run university for social work and education, many students are local Bavarians or study part-time, so a smaller share applies for dorm rooms than at large universities.

What to check
- Most bachelor programmes in Germany are taught in German; daily life and studies require at minimum B2 level.
- Non-EU school leavers may need to complete a preparatory year (Studienkolleg) before university admission is possible.
- Germany requires proof of funds via a blocked account (Sperrkonto) of around €11,904 for the visa — significant upfront capital.
- International students are allowed only 120 full or 240 half working days per year, limiting earnings.
- München has one of Germany's most competitive rental markets; finding affordable accommodation takes time and planning.
